Scams getting more convincing with AI

Imposter scams are already bilking people out of money, but now, with the help of artificial intelligence (AI), they will get much more convincing.

These scams are frequently directed at parents and grandparents. Fraudsters will call people and claim that a loved one, such as a child or grandchild, has been in a serious car accident, suffered some type of medical emergency, or been arrested. The criminals will say you need to hand over money immediately, if you want to help them. Sometimes scammers themselves claim to be the child or grandchild who needs money for bail or another crisis.

Tornado Watch until 5pmCT on Monday

The National Weather Service Storm Prediction Center in Norman, OK, has issued a tornado watch through 5pmCT/6pmET on Monday, August 7, 2023, for parts of Kentucky that include Adair and all surrounding counties.

A Tornado Watch is issued by the National Weather Service when conditions are favorable for the development of tornadoes in and close to the watch area. Their size can vary depending on the weather situation. They are usually issued for a duration of 4 to 8 hours. They normally are issued well in advance of the actual occurrence of severe weather. During the watch, people should review tornado safety rules and be prepared to move a place of safety if threatening weather approaches.

It's Lighthouse Day - where's your favorite one?

August 7, 2023 - Lighthouse Day. Lighthouses, with their towering structures and beaming lights, have served as guiding beacons for centuries, ensuring the safe passage of ships and guarding lives at sea.

Ancient lighthouses were often nothing more than fires built on raised platforms or hills, but they proved so important for navigation that they soon became dramatic structures.

One of the first, most famous towers was the Pharos of Alexandria, constructed around 280 B.C. in Egypt, considered one of the Seven Wonders of the Ancient World.

Taylor Co. Board of Education awarded $450K grant

Campbellsville, KY - The Taylor County Board of Education has been awarded a Stronger Connections Grant by the Kentucky Department of Education in the amount of $450,000.

The Stronger Connections Grant is a one-time, competitive grant for an award period of up to three years. The program is funded through the Bipartisan Safer Communities Act (BSCA) of 2022 to help local education agencies and schools establish safe, healthy, and supportive learning opportunities and environments.

ACSO: One injured in Sunday afternoon motorcycle collision

From Sheriff Josh Brockman
Adair County Sheriff's Office

On Sunday, August 6, 2023, at approx 4:01pmCT, Adair County 911 received a call about an injury collision. The incident was reported 9 miles east of Columbia on Allen Schoolhouse Road.

Upon arrival and preliminary investigation it was found that Mathew Lee, 47, of Knifley, was traveling east on Allan School House Road on a 2006 Harley Davidson, when he failed to negotiate a curve and left the roadway.

Lee was treated on scene by Adair County EMS, then transported to TJ Health Columbia. The collision was investigated by Sheriff Josh Brockman.
